About this course

On completion of this programme, delegates will be able to:
Explain the legal framework  and guidance surrounding Safeguarding and the impact this has on their role.
Identify both national and local level standard operating procedures
Recognise the importance of taking a multi-disciplinary approach
Examine the role of the trainer including methods of delivery and structure
Implement a training programme to enhance staff engagement and wider promotion of the subject.
Demonstrate a proactive presence within their organisation to ensure staff and procedural compliance
Analyse risk  factors that influence the likelihood of incidents occurring
Identify factors that influence the whistleblowing process and how to combat these
Devise bespoke prevention strategies relevant to your organisation
Implement person centred care strategies to assist in an prevention strategy
Identify the importance of Dignity, Choice, Consent, Respect, Individuality and the role these play in reducing allegations
Examine how the Champion’s initiatives system impact the engagement of the whistleblowing procedure
Identify the impact confidentiality plays and the role this takes in the disclosure process.

This course is aimed at all Social care staff, particularly those in a hands on role and an ambition to influence change and promote Safeguarding to a wider audience.

Course programme

This course has a high level of practical involvement which may include individual and group teaching, as well as active participation in group activites.
THIS IS A TWO DAY PROGRAMME COMPLETION OF BOTH DAYS IS ESSENTIAL TO OBTAIN YOUR CERTIFICATE AND SKILLS TO DELIVER AND INFLUENCE CHANGEIN YOUR ORGANISATION.
dESIGN AND IMPLEMENT A SAFEGUARDING CHAMPIONS STRATEGY IN YOU R PLACE OF WORK.
ON COMPLETION OF THE COURSE THE DELEGATE WILL RECIEVE ALL NECESSARY RESOURCES TO START TRAINING, INCLUDING POWERPOINT PRESENTIONS, GROUP ACTIVITIES AND CASE STUDIES

Additional information

Course Pre Requisites You should have volunteered for the training with the agreement and support of your Manager Individuals should have attended previous Safeguarding Training Be familiar with the theoretical knowledge of the subject and the wider Social Care Sector Be experienced and have practical experience in frontline care delivery.
